← Back

Wang Qiang

Wang Qiang

Born: 1963-08-02 • Jixi,Heilongjiang Province,China

No biography available.

Filmography
Operation Red Sea poster
Operation Red Sea
2018 • Political commissar
In the Deep of Winter poster
In the Deep of Winter
2017 • Chen Caibao
A Touch of Sin poster
A Touch of Sin
2013
Decisive Battle poster
Decisive Battle
2009
Soldiers of Huang Pu poster
Soldiers of Huang Pu
2001
Death Inn poster
Death Inn
1988 • Xue Cangzhou